Charity organisation British Red Cross has completed a review of its property advisers, with regional firms Blake Lapthorn and Harrison Clark landing key roles. The regional duo have been added to the organisation's preferred firms list alongside longstanding advisers DLA Piper, following a review by British Red Cross property head John Walford.The firms will work closely with the charity on a number of matters including property, property litigation and construction.

Clifford Chance (CC) has bolstered its US antitrust offering with the high-profile hire of former Federal Trade Commission (FTC) general counsel, William Blumenthal. Blumenthal joins as a partner in the firm's corporate and litigation groups in New York, and will act as chairman of the antitrust group.At the FTC, Blumenthal represented the governmental body in front of federal and state courts, in addition to advising on proposed legislation, supervising reports to the US President and advising on policy.

Welsh heavyweight Morgan Cole has bolstered its Bristol presence after merging with insurance specialists CIP Solicitors, it was announced today (6 January). The tie-up, which goes live on 1 February, will see CIP Solicitors' four partners - Deborah Bradley, Richard Ottley, Ian Poole and Zoe Morgan - plus 40 lawyers and 31 support staff all come under the banner of Morgan Cole in Bristol, creating a 100-strong team.Morgan Cole's Bristol-based lawyers will move into CIP's offices in South Plaza.

Clifford Chance has named litigator David DiBari as its new Washington DC managing partner. DiBari will take charge of the 11-partner and 50 fee earner office, working closely with regional managing partner Craig Medwick.He replaces former head Leiv Blad, who left the firm in November with two other lawyers for Bingham McCutchen. Since Blad's departure, Medwick has managed both the Washington and New York offices.

The economic downturn has turned the spotlight away from transactional departments and towards litigation and regulatory teams. The judges chose White & Case to receive this year's award on the back of its extraordinary caseload. Arguably the most important case was the successful House of Lords appeal by former Morgan Crucible chief executive Ian Norris over the US Department of Justice's attempts to extradite him by re-characterising price-fixing as conspiracy to defraud.

Clifford Chance (CC) has become the latest firm to cut back bonuses for US associates, with the announcement that it is to halve its year-end payouts. The US arm of the magic circle firm will award bonuses ranging from a pro-rated $17,500 (£12,000) for first-year associates to $32,500 (£22,000) for eighth-year associates - a significant decrease on last year, when the firm awarded bonuses ranging from $35,000 (£24,000) to $65,000 (£44,500).The new figures put CC in line with its US competitors, after a raft of Stateside firms, including Davis Polk & Wardwell, Skadden Arps Slate Meagher & Flom and Cravath Swaine & Moore, slashed bonuses in response to the economic downturn.
